We can see this clearly in cities, where the "smart city" idea often embodies our modern fascination with scalable design. Take Masdar City, an ambitious project initiated in 2006 by the Abu Dhabi government to become the world's first zero-carbon, zero-waste city. Built into the desert and backed by cutting-edge green technology, Masdar was envisioned as a template for future urbanism: compact, efficient, automated, and endlessly optimised.
But more than a decade later, Masdar remains only partially realised. The Personal Rapid Transit Pods, once a symbol of its futuristic vision, operate on a limited loop. Much of the development stalled after the global financial crisis. The problem wasn't the lack of ambition but the assumption that urban life could be engineered like a machine.
Shannon Mattern notes in her book A City Is Not a Computer (2021) that cities are not codebases. They are "ecological, relational, and evolutionary." They grow through friction and negotiation, not just clean input-output loops. What Masdar failed to account for wasn't infrastructure but emergence, the way culture, economy, and daily life defy prediction and resist central planning. The smart city promised control. However, in seeking to scale urban life through technology, it missed what makes cities resilient: messiness, adaptability, and human
nuance.
The same misconception of scale appears in our digital worlds. Consider the case of Facebook, which began in 2004 as a social platform for Harvard students. The early version of Facebook worked because it operated within a clearly defined social context, a relatively small, high-trust community where informal norms defined behaviour. But as the platform scaled to billions of users across cultures, languages, and political systems, the assumptions underpinning its original design began to crumble.
In Antisocial Media (2018), Siva Vaidhyanathan says that Facebook was "built to serve a campus conversation, not to mediate power at the scale of nations." What was once a tool for connection became a stage for misinformation, polarisation, and algorithmic manipulation. Moderation systems strained under the weight of cultural nuance, and design decisions made early on, like frictionless sharing or friend-suggestion algorithms, played out very differently on a planetary scale than on a college campus. Again, it wasn't simply a problem of feature bloat or technical limitation.
It was a more profound misunderstanding: scaling a social system is not just about reaching more people. It's about navigating entirely new forms of complexity. When platforms grow without reimagining their ethical, relational, and civic responsibilities, they collapse under the weight of their influence.
This pattern isn't limited to cities or software. Agriculture tells a similar story. Smallholder farmers cultivated crops adapted to local climates and ecologies for thousands of years. These systems were biodiverse, cyclical, and self-correcting. But in the 20th century, the Green Revolution promised to "scale up" food production to meet global demand. Yields initially increased through monocultures, synthetic fertilisers, pesticides, and high-yield seed varieties. But so did the externalities: soil degradation, groundwater depletion, pest resistance, and the collapse of local food systems.
In her book Staying Alive (1989), Vandana Shiva argues that this shift replaced an ecosystem with an assembly line. She talks about how diversity creates stability and uniformity creates vulnerability. Traditional agricultural systems' rootedness in place, seasons, and ancestral knowledge made them resilient. But scaling for output ignored this complexity. It produced food, but at the cost of long-term ecological and social health.
All three examples, Masdar City, Facebook, and industrial agriculture, illuminate a key insight: scale doesn't just stretch a system; it transforms it. If we don't redesign for that transformation, we introduce fragility into systems that once felt strong. This matters deeply for design practitioners today.
Whether we're building products, teams, platforms, or services, we operate under constant pressure to scale. Funders look for reach. Stakeholders chase exponential curves. Growing a system is proof of its worth. But in that pursuit, we often forget to ask: What is being lost as we grow?
We've seen this in our practices. A design system that worked beautifully for a small team becomes hard to maintain when handed across departments. A startup that thrives on tight collaboration loses coherence when it doubles in size. A product that delighted early adopters begins to feel generic as it's pushed to broader markets. Sometimes, this loss is operational: more stakeholders, slower decisions, and reduced agility. But often, it's existential, a slow erosion of meaning, culture, and clarity.
So, what would it look like to scale wisely? Scale not just for growth but for resilience. For one, it would mean recognising that scale is not a goal; it's a design constraint. Like material limits or accessibility standards, the scale should prompt us to rethink form. What structures must change? What principles must evolve? What needs to be localised, modularised, or made optional? It would also mean embracing non-linear growth. Not every system should grow indefinitely.
As Donella Meadows says in The Limits to Growth (1972), exponential growth within a finite system leads to collapse. Sometimes, the most sustainable path is to pause, consolidate, or even shrink. As Joseph Tainter puts it in The Collapse of Complex Societies (1988), "Collapse is not always a failure. It can be a rational response to diminishing returns on complexity."
In practice, designing for scale might look like:
1. Creating modular systems rather than monolithic ones so parts can evolve independently without breaking the whole.
2. Building tools that invite interpretation rather than enforcing uniformity.
3. Investing in governance and feedback loops as much as in features.
4. Designing for adaptation, not just automation.
5. Measuring success not just by numbers, but by depth of engagement, impact, and care.
We could also redefine what it means to scale. Not every community needs to become a platform, and not every product needs to reach millions. Some of the most powerful systems are small, intentional, and situated. And some things, intimacy, trust, and craftsmanship, don't scale well and shouldn't.
This is not a rejection of scale. It's a call to scale with consciousness, to ask: What are we amplifying? What are we erasing? And how do we know when to stop? Growth is not neutral. It changes everything: structure, relationships, and purpose.
